Is CM Punk injured after AJ Styles' kick on WWE RAW during MITB qualifier?

‘The Best in the World’ faced off against AJ Styles and El Grande Americano in a triple threat clash
CM Punk may have walked away from this week’s WWE Monday Night RAW looking strong after saving Jey Uso and Sami Zayn from a post-match beatdown, but fans are left wondering whether ‘The Best in the World’ suffered a potential injury during his intense triple-threat Money In The Bank qualifier.
During the high-stakes match against AJ Styles and El Grande Americano, a pivotal moment occurred when Styles delivered a stiff Styles Clash, followed by a sharp kick that appeared to catch Punk square on the nose.
While the match ended with Americano securing a surprise win, thanks to a perfectly timed mid-air headbutt to counter Styles’ Phenomenal Forearm, the buzz afterward was all about Punk’s condition.
You’re a legend: CM Punk to AJ Styles
CM Punk later took to Instagram to share a heartfelt message to AJ Styles, indirectly addressing the blow he took during the bout.

The image he posted hinted at a possible nose injury, sparking widespread speculation among fans. However, neither Punk nor WWE has issued an official statement confirming whether he suffered a broken nose or any other injury.
Despite the possible knock, Punk appeared later in the night to help even the odds during the tag team bout between Jey Uso & Sami Zayn and the powerhouse duo of Bron Breakker & Bronson Reed.
After Seth Rollins interfered in the tag match, hitting Uso with a blackout to cause a disqualification, Punk made a surprise run-in, wielding a steel chair and fending off Breakker and Reed. He also came face-to-face with Rollins, teasing a possible future clash.
The match itself had already delivered on drama. CM Punk, Styles, and Americano went toe-to-toe in a thrilling qualifier, each coming close to victory. Punk nearly won with a Go To Sleep, but Americano broke it up with an ankle lock counter. Moments later, it was Styles who took the upper hand before Americano swooped in for the win.
At this point, there’s no official confirmation about CM Punk’s injury status. His later appearance suggests he’s doing fine, but if it turns out to be a storyline cover or a delayed medical update, WWE may reveal more in the coming days.
Until then, it appears CM Punk will continue to play a key role on Monday Nights and possibly have a big showdown with Seth Rollins in the near future.
